Abstract

A method of policy management in a Data Loss Prevention (DLP) system uses a policy model that associates a user with one or more DLP endpoints. When an endpoint is added to the system, a set of policies for that endpoint are determined using an identity of the user that is associated with the endpoint and a list of roles or groups for that user. At policy distribution time, the method determines a set of endpoints to which the policy is to be distributed.

Claims (45)

1. A method of policy management in a data loss prevention (DLP) system, comprising:

defining a policy model that associates a user with one or more endpoints, the user being associated with at least one role or group;

determining a set of policies for an endpoint in the DLP system using an identity of the user that is associated with the endpoint and a list of roles or groups for the user, wherein the set of policies for the endpoint reference each role or group to which the user is associated; and

determining a set of endpoints to which a policy is to be distributed by:

identifying the user owning the endpoint;

retrieving a list of roles or groups for that user; and

defining the set of policies as the policies that reference each role or group to which the user is associated;

wherein at least one of the determining steps is performed using a computer program executing in a hardware element.

2. The method as described in claim 1 wherein the step of determining the set of endpoints to which the policy is to be distributed generates an endpoint set.

3. The method as described in claim 2 wherein the endpoint set for the policy is generated by the following sub-steps:

for each role or group that is a target of the policy, identifying each user associated with the role or group;

for each user associated with the role or group, identifying a list of one or more endpoints with which the user is associated; and

adding the one or more endpoints from the list into the endpoint set.

4. The method as described in claim 3 further including generating a policy distribution list that includes the endpoint set associated with one or more policies to be distributed to the endpoints.

5. The method as described in claim 4 further including distributing each policy included in the distribution list to the endpoints identified in its associated endpoint set.
